Geography

Mongolia vs. Vietnam - comparison of geographical features.

Country area

The surface area of Mongolia is 603 906 mi², while the surface area of Vietnam is 127 882 mi². This means that the area of Mongolia is 372% larger.

Coastline length

Mongolia has a coastline of 0.0 mi, while Vietnam has a coastline of 2 140.0 mi.

Largest city

The largest city in Mongolia is Ulaanbaatar, with a population of about 1 372 000 people. In contrast, the largest city in Vietnam is Ho Chi Minh, where the population is 7 981 900.

Highest peak

The highest peak in Mongolia is Khüiten Peak, its height is 14 350 ft. The highest peak in Vietnam is Fan Si Pan, which rises to a height of 10 312 ft.

Highest recorded temperature

In Mongolia, the highest temperature ever measured was 111.2°F and was recorded in Khongor, while in Vietnam the highest temperature was 108.9°F and was recorded in Con Cuong.

Lowest recorded temperature

In Mongolia, the lowest temperature ever measured was -68.8°F and was recorded in Uvs Lake, while in Vietnam, the lowest temperature was 21°F and was recorded in Sa Pa.

Society

Mongolia vs. Vietnam - comparison of aspects of social life.

Population

The population of Mongolia is about 3 278 290, while Vietnam is home to 97 338 579 people.

Life expectancy

Life expectancy is 71.1 years in Mongolia and 75.3 years in Vietnam.

Average age

The average age is 29.8 years in Mongolia and 31.9 years in Vietnam.

Birthrate

The birth rate is 0.93% in Mongolia and 1% in Vietnam.

Literacy

Literacy is 99.2% in Mongolia and 95.8% in Vietnam.

Language

In Mongolia, the main language is Mongolian, and in Vietnam the primary language is Vietnamese.

Religion

In Mongolia, the main religion is Buddhism; in Vietnam, the main religion is Buddhism.

Electricity

Electricity in Mongolia: frequency and voltage are 230V 50 Hz (plug type: C, E). Electricity in Vietnam: frequency and voltage are 220V 50 Hz (plug type: A, C, D).

Best months to visit

The best months in terms of weather are: Mongolia - June, July, August; Vietnam - January, February, March, April, December.
